Indications of Oral Emergency Situations



Acknowledging the signs of dental emergencies is crucial for timely activity and appropriate treatment. If you experience severe tooth discomfort that's constant and pain, it might indicate an underlying concern that requires prompt focus.

Swelling in the gum tissues, face, or jaw can additionally signify a dental emergency, particularly if it's accompanied by pain or fever. Any kind of kind of trauma to the mouth resulting in a fractured, damaged, or knocked-out tooth must be dealt with as an emergency situation to stop more damages and prospective infection.

Bleeding from the mouth that does not stop after applying stress for a couple of mins is an additional red flag that you need to look for emergency situation dental treatment.
